After a night of drinking, canceled comedian Dean Blackshaw is found dead in a comedy club green room. Now his friend and fellow comic, Anne-Marie, has to put together the pieces of a blacked-out night, solve the crime, and wonder if it was all her fault.

A murder mystery audio drama created by Brandon Rizzuto. Produced by Evagation Media.

Frequently Asked Questions About Dean's Killer Joke

What is Dean's Killer Joke about and what kind of topics does it cover?

The podcast features a gripping narrative centered on the dark and tumultuous world of comedy, illustrated through the lens of a murder mystery. Following the death of controversial comedian Dean Blackshaw, listeners are taken on a journey as his friend, Anne-Marie, attempts to unravel the chaotic events leading up to his demise. Through a series of introspective episodes, themes of mental health, accountability, and the repercussions of comedy are explored, with Anne-Marie reflecting on her complicity and the societal implications of jokes. The storytelling blends humor with tragedy, creating a unique experience that resonates deeply with both comedy enthusiasts and those intrigued by intricate human relationships and moral dilemmas.
